Darby Power, LLC

Natural gas power plant · Pickaway County, Ohio

Nameplate capacity
564 MW
Rank in Ohio
#25
of 219 plants
In service since
2001
May 2001

Details

Primary fuel
Natural gas
Technology
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ine
Operator
Darby Power, LLC
County
Pickaway County
Generating units
6
Share of state capacity
1.58%
Rank among natural gas plants in Ohio
#18 of 51
EIA plant code
55247

Generating units

Individual generating units at Darby Power, LLC
UnitTechnologyNameplateSummerOnlineStatus
GT1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ine94 MW80 MW2001Operating
GT2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ine94 MW80 MW2001Operating
GT3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ine94 MW80 MW2001Operating
GT4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ine94 MW80 MW2001Operating
GT5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ine94 MW80 MW2002Operating
GT6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ine94 MW80 MW2002Operating

Nameplate is the maximum rated output; summer capacity is what the unit can reliably deliver on a hot day, which is typically lower.

About this data

From EIA’s inventory of operable generators, May 2026 release. Capacity is nameplate — the maximum rated output of the equipment, not what the plant actually generates over a year, which depends on how often it runs. A 564 MW solar plant and a 564 MW nuclear plant have the same entry here and produce very different amounts of electricity.
